Resharper 最有用的代码分析工具之一是如果在解决方案中发现没有使用,则将符号标记为未使用。
不幸的是,单元测试涵盖的任何符号都被视为已使用。
=>我正在寻找一种方法来忽略此使用分析的单元测试。
浏览 Resharper 选项,我发现了一个标有“编辑要跳过的项目”的按钮。它有一个很长的描述文本,其中包括“......如果解决方案中的某个符号仅在您跳过的文件中使用,则该符号将突出显示为从未使用过。”
这听起来正是我想要的。但是,将单元测试项目放在跳过列表中不仅会显示任何有效未使用的符号,而且只会禁用测试项目的整个代码分析。当然,我仍然想编写好的单元测试代码,从而利用 Resharper 的所有代码分析功能。我只是不想计算测试项目之外的符号使用情况。
有任何想法吗?